#4a3fd2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4a3fd2 is composed of 29% red, 24.7%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.8% cyan, 70%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 244.5 degrees, a saturation of 62% and a lightness of 53.5%. #4a3fd2 color hex could be obtained by blending #947eff with #0000a5.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#4a3fd2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4a3fd2 has RGB values of R:74, G:63,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0.7,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 4866002.

Shades and Tints of #4a3fd2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04030f is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4a3fd2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888889 is the less saturated color, while #2b1bf6 is the most saturated one.
